Second, the reason you can't set higher resolutions is that you need to install an additional driver for your video card. Without this driver, Windows is limited to the 16 color, 640 by 480 pixel screen you have.
You can get the drivers from the web site of your video card's manufacturer. If you don't know what kind of video card you have, there are several options:
1. Look in the documentation and on the CDs that came with your computer.
2. Open the computer up, remove the video card, and look.
3. The video card's guts are probably made by either nVidia or ATI. Download drivers from both companies and try to install them-- they won't install unless you have the right card, so it's pretty safe.
